Echoes of Elegance: Discover the Heartbeat of Culture at Mahalia Jackson Theater

Nestled in the vibrant heart of New Orleans, the Mahalia Jackson Theater stands as a beacon of cultural richness and artistic expression. Named after the legendary gospel singer, this historic venue hosts a variety of performances, from soul-stirring concerts to captivating dance productions. Surrounded by the lush beauty of Louis Armstrong Park, visitors can immerse themselves in the city's unique blend of music, art, and history. Whether you're attending a spectacular show or simply exploring the nearby cultural attractions, the Mahalia Jackson Theater offers an unforgettable experience that embodies the spirit of New Orleans. What to eat near Mahalia Jackson Theater

Here are some top-rated dishes near Mahalia Jackson Theater, New Orleans, Louisiana, United States of America:

  • Gumbo: A hearty stew that embodies the essence of New Orleans cuisine, gumbo is a blend of influences, featuring a rich roux, and often includes ingredients like sausage, seafood, and okra. Served over rice, it’s a communal dish perfect for sharing with friends and family, often enjoyed during lively gatherings.
  • Jambalaya: This iconic one-pot dish is a celebration of local flavors, combining rice with a mix of meats—such as chicken, sausage, and shrimp—along with vegetables and spices. Jambalaya reflects the region’s culinary diversity and is a staple at local festivities, showcasing the vibrant spirit of New Orleans.
  • Beignets: These delightful, powdered-sugar-dusted pastries are a must-try when visiting. Often enjoyed with café au lait, beignets are a symbol of New Orleans' café culture, making them a sweet treat that pairs well with the city’s lively atmosphere.

Best time to go to Mahalia Jackson Theater

Mahalia Jackson Theater exper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 54.9°F (12.7°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 83.8°F (28.8°C). August is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ere at Mahalia Jackson Theater, February, March, and September are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, April, May, and August are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light to moderate r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
